Club News: Christian Eriksen has responded to debate around his playing position at Manchester United

Manchester United midfielder Christian Eriksen has opened up on what he believes is his best position at the club.

The midfielder joined United this summer on a free transfer from Brentford. Since his arrival, there were questions about what role he would play since Bruno Fernandes had been playing as the number 10 for the club.

Eriksen has mainly been playing as a deep-lying midfielder along with Scott McTominay in the middle of the park for the Red Devils. Now, the 30-year-old addressed the matter in an interview with MUTV (h/t Manchester Evening News).

“I don’t know, I’m quite surprised about all the positional things. All the games, even when I was at Spurs, I started as a winger but would often drop down to get the ball, collect it and help the build-up back then so that hasn’t really changed in that sense.”

Since joining the club, the Danish international has been one of our best players. Eriksen has completely transformed the United midfield with McTominay as his usual partner.

He has started in all eight games for the club so far in all competitions. While he is yet to find the back of the net, his role as a deep-lying playmaker has amazed spectators and exceeded expectations.

A fan-favourite already, the Dane also was named United’s player of the month for September by the fans. It is clear that Erik ten Hag’s tactics have worked perfectly and the current role suits the 30-year-old attacking midfielder.

The midfielder was also called up for international duty last month. He played in both the games for Denmark against Croatia and France for their UEFA Nations League group stage games. The Dane scored in the 2-1 defeat to Croatia while playing an important part in the 2-0 win against France.
